Geography of Drinking More International Geography. Colder, darker climates increase alcohol consumption. That is, people living in cold regions of the world drink more alcohol. WebADVERTISEMENTS: Here is an essay on the ‘Zoo-Geographical Regions of the World’ especially written for school and college students. 1. Essay on Palaearctic Region: The areas of this region extend to whole of the Europe, China, Japan, Africa, North Sahara, Siberia, Mediterranian, Manchuria, Asia north of Himalaya and north of Arabia. WebEast of the Urals, in south-central Russia, is Russia’s Eastern Frontier, a region of planned cities, industrial plants, and raw-material processing centers. The population is centered in two zones here: the Kuznetsk Basin (or Kuzbas, for short) and the Lake Baikal region. The Kuzbas is a region of coal, iron ore, and bauxite mining; timber ...
